Enhance Your Site Speed: The Art of Image Optimization
Images are vital for any website, but they can also be a major culprit behind slow loading times. Thankfully, there are several strategies you can use to enhance your images and significantly boost your website's speed.
One of the easiest ways to compress image size is by choosing the appropriate file format. JPEGs are ideal for detailed images, while PNGs are preferable for images with sharp lines and text.
Consider using a tool to reduce your image files before you upload them to your website. There are many free tools available that can efficiently reduce your images without significantly changing their quality.
Another key factor is to choose the right image resolution. Stay away from uploading images that are larger than necessary for your website. Scale down images to the suitable size before you upload them to ensure they load fast.

Optimize Your Images for Lightning-Fast Loading Times
In the dynamic world of web design, user experience reigns supreme. One crucial factor influencing site performance is image loading speed. Heavy images can cripple your website, driving away visitors and hindering search engine rankings. Luckily, you can reduce your images without sacrificing quality, ensuring a smoother browsing experience for your audience. By implementing effective image optimization techniques, you can significantly boost your site's loading times, leaving a positive impression on users and improving overall performance.
- Employ modern image formats like WebP for smaller file sizes without compromising visual fidelity.
- Compress image dimensions to match the display area, avoiding unnecessary data transfer.
- Implement responsive images that automatically scale to different screen sizes, ensuring optimal rendering on all devices.
